The deep, booming Seems of bass drums can be listened to from extensive distances. The flair and machismo of a tassa team generally falls to your bass player, the enjoying sort of which might range between stationary and reserved to flamboyant, intense and punishing, the latter of which has been termed "split absent". When two or maybe more teams compete, it is usually the loudest bass drum(s) which may more info result in victory.
Mukh Darshan: Get With this queue for A fast think about the idol from the length. The wait time for this sneak peek alone can vary from 6 to seven hours.
Over the years, Mumbai’s Ganesh Chaturthi celebrations had increased in sizing and scale, with pandals competing with one another to put up the largest, grandest show. For Lalbaugcha Raja, famed because the Navasacha Ganpati or the would like-satisfying Ganesha, it meant more time serpentine queues—men and women waited in line for over forty eight hrs within a queue that was quite a few kilometres very long, for the glimpse of their beloved Ganpati.
